I got the original zune when it was first released. I was living in Auckland in New Zealand at the time so I had to import it.
I liked it. It was a bit bulky but had a good build. ipod is probably a better option if I'm honest but it's still a good player.
The wifi exchange thing they had was stupid. It let you send songs to other zunes but once they were received you could only play them 3 times. What the hell is the point in that.
